Methods for JPT to PNG Conversion

There isn't a dedicated "JPT to PNG" converter tool. The process involves using image editing or design software along with potentially a text editor or transcription tool. Here's a general workflow:

  1. Prepare your JPT: Ensure your Japanese phonetic text is accurate and correctly formatted. Use a text editor to ensure proper spacing and line breaks.
  2. Choose your image editor: Software like Adobe Photoshop, GIMP (GNU Image Manipulation Program – a free and open-source alternative), or even simpler online tools can be used. The choice depends on your skill level and the desired level of customization.
  3. Create a new image: Set the dimensions appropriate for your text.
  4. Add text to the image: Use the text tool in your chosen software. Select a suitable font – Japanese fonts are essential for accurate rendering of Kana or Romaji. Adjust font size, color, and style as needed.
  5. Export as PNG: Once you're satisfied with the image, export it as a PNG file. This preserves the quality and clarity of your text.
